Application Scenarios

Automobile Tire Mold Cleaning

Revolutionizing the automotive industry, the Cupid Series efficiently cleans tire molds, removing grease, rubber residue, and other contaminants, ensuring superior mold quality and prolonging mold life.

Automotive Industry Parts Rust and Paint Removal

Replacing traditional processes, the Cupid Series laser cleaning machine efficiently removes rust, paint, and other coatings from automotive parts, without damaging the underlying metal surface. This not only enhances part quality but also accelerates production processes.

PVD Coating Removal

Efficiently eliminating metal surface coatings, the Cupid Series minimizes the harmful effects of chemicals on the environment. It is ideal for PVD coating removal, ensuring a clean and safe work environment.

Electrophoretic Paint Cleaning

For metal surfaces requiring thorough cleaning of oil, oxidation, and other residues, the Cupid Series delivers exceptional results. Its precision laser technology ensures a spotless finish, ready for the next stage of production or coating.
